Kathryn "Kay" Johnson passed away peacefully, on October 3, 2010, at Parmly LifePointes. Born Kathryn Jean Nelson, on December 2, 1934, at Bethesda Lutheran Hospsital in St. Paul, MN, she was the only child of Phillip and Margaret Nelson. She was raised at Squirrel Beach Resort, on South Lindstrom Lake, on the "line" of Lindstrom and Chisago City. As a result, she attended both Chisago City and Lindstrom Schools, graduating from Lindstrom Chi-Hi School in 1952. She attended St. Cloud State University for two years to study teaching.

She married Charles Wesley "Ace" Johnson, June 4, 1955. They raised two children, Robyn Kay and Ross Michael.

Her working years included a variety of positions; waitressing at the well remembered Rainbow Café in Lindstrom in her younger years, in the office of the Chisago County Press, allowing her to assist in research during the years Wilhelm Moberg was here researching his books, and she was a major player assisting her parents in running the "Beacon Inn" restaurant. These all led her to her most cherished position - as teacher's aide at both Chisago Lakes Primary and Lakeside Schools. It was there that she looked forward to going to work every day to see "her kids". Forced to retire in 1997 after 22 years due to health reasons, she missed her work, "her kids" and her co-workers every single day. She will be remembered for the wonderful wife, mother, and friend, she was; but also for her love of gardening, her incredible cooking skills, her love of dancing and swing music, World War II history and old movies, her love of children and helping them learn, a fabulous sense of humor, and her devotion to her many friendships.

She is preceded in death by her parents, Phillip and Margaret Nelson. She is survived by her husband Charles Wesley "Ace" Johnson; daughter Robyn (Michael) Savold; son Ross (Andrea) Johnson; grandchildren Katie and Molly Savold, and Morgan, Tyler and Hallie Johnson; God daughter Claudia (Bruce) Hagberg; many cousins, relatives and friends. She touched many lives and will be missed greatly by all who knew her.
